Subject: Kiosk watchdog update rolling out tonight

Hi support crew,

Quick heads up: the Pavenor kiosk watchdog now restarts the shell within 10 seconds of a freeze instead of the old 60. That means fewer "screen stuck on the welcome page" calls, but you may see kiosks briefly flash a reboot spinner. Totally expected. If a unit reboots more than three times an hour, escalate as usual — that's still a hardware flag. Rollout finishes by Friday. For reference, the watchdog ships in the build listed below.

build token for kagaf-hahof: htk14_9d3d4d26d7d8de

**Action item AI-7 (owner: platform team, due next sprint):** Extract the user module from the Brimstack monolith into a standalone Personhood service. During the outage, a deadlock in the shared user table blocked checkout, billing, and notifications simultaneously, confirming the coupling risk we flagged last quarter. First milestone is a read-only facade with shadow traffic; writes migrate only after two weeks of parity checks. Scope boundaries, the table ownership matrix, and the cutover plan are drafted on the page below.

operations page: https://jenkins.zemvarcloud.local/job/merge_requests/repo/build/73930b4b30f0a8ed

**Ticket PARITY-412: Kestrel SDK catch-up**

Quick one for the weekly sync: the Kestrel-Go SDK is still missing batched uploads and retry hints that Kestrel-JS shipped two releases ago. Partner teams keep asking. Plan is to land both behind a flag this sprint and cut a minor release. Needs a sign-off from the owner named below.

account owner for bajef-badup: Drueth Kelath Pelael Holwyn